Understanding the Causes of Broken Windows
Before diving into repair processes, it's essential to understand what typically triggers window damage. Acknowledging these causes can likewise help property owners in boosting preventive steps. Here is a list of some typical causes of broken windows:
Accidental Impact: Glass can break due to unintentional accidents, such as a ball being tossed or items being dropped.Serious Weather: Extreme weather condition conditions, consisting of hail, high winds, and heavy snowfall, can damage windows.Aging Materials: Over time, windows may establish weak points due to rust, rot, or other age-related wear and tear.Burglary: Unfortunately, windows might be broken during tried break-ins.Thermal Stress: Rapid temperature level changes can cause the glass to broaden or agreement, causing fractures.Examining the Damage
Before undertaking repairs, it's vital to evaluate the extent of the damage. Windows can suffer various types of damage, consisting of:
Cracks: Minor surface-level fractures frequently do not need complete replacement but need timely attention to prevent additional damage.Shattered Glass: This circumstance usually requires full panel replacement.Frame Damage: If the window frame is split or deformed, this may need addressing independently from the glass.Repair Methods1. Spot Repair
For small fractures, a spot repair may be sufficient. This process involves:
Cleaning the damaged area.Applying clear epoxy or a glass adhesive.Enabling it to treat according to the producer's directions.
Please note that spots are short-term and might not bring back the window's initial integrity.
2. Caulking
Sometimes, windows might appear broken due to seal failures rather than physical damage. This typically results in foggy or cloudy appearances. To restore clarity, follow these steps:
Remove any old caulk and debris around the window edges.Tidy surfaces with alcohol.Use a fresh bead of silicone-caulk around the window border.3. Glass Replacement
When the glass is shattered, replacement is needed. Here's a general outline of the process:
Remove the harmed window by loosening or spying out the old frame.Measure the dimensions of the glass to cut a new piece accurately.Secure brand-new glass into the window frame with glazing compound or putty.Finish with a careful application of caulking.4. Frame Replacement
If the frame is harmed, more significant repairs or replacements might be essential:
Remove the old frame and thoroughly examine adjacent structures.Install a new frame, repairing it safely.Re-install the glass panel and use the necessary seals.Cost Considerations
The expense of broken window repair can differ extensively based upon a number of elements, including:
Type of Damage: Minor repairs will generally cost less than complete replacements.Material: The kind of glass and frame product substantially influence the rate.Labor Costs: Hiring experts sustains additional expenses compared to DIY jobs.Average Repair CostsType of RepairEstimated Cost RangePatch Repairs₤ 50 - ₤ 100Caulking₤ 30 - ₤ 75Glass Replacement₤ 200 - ₤ 400Frame Replacement₤ 300 - ₤ 600
Keep in mind: These price quotes can differ based on area and particular project requirements.

Higher expenses.Arranging restraints.Frequently Asked Questions1. How can I ensure my windows are safe after repair?
Ensure that you effectively secure new setups, check seals, and frequently preserve frames and glasses to prevent future issues.
2. How long does a broken window repair normally take?
The timeline depends on the level of the damage. Spot repairs might take a couple of hours, while complete replacements may need a day or more.
3. Is it worth repairing old windows?
If the frames remain in great condition, repairing might be more affordable than changing. Nevertheless, older windows might justify a complete replacement for increased effectiveness.
4. What tools do I need for a DIY window repair?
Basic toolkit products such as an utility knife, measuring tape, hammer, and safety goggles will be sufficient for minor repairs. For glass replacement, additional tools like glazier points and a glass cutter might be required.
